Total quality includes the quality of the decorations in addition to the base quality of the item.  I'm less sure about the bins that go into such stockpiles, but I *think* they're not affected.  I have so many bins that I've never really paid attention.  Then again, I don't think I've ever had an artifact bin and I *know* that some of my artifacts get shoved into bins in artifact-only piles.

The only things I use quality for are to put high quality furniture near the jeweler's shop so they can encrust it and to pull artifacts out of whatever stockpile they got shoved into and get them into my artifact vault(s).

pretty sure it has nothing to do with the bin.  I'm also pretty sure core quality is the quality ignoring decorations.  Logically the definition of total quality would be the highest quality from among the item itself and the decorations.  I've had some degree of success turning these on and off to ensure only the mastwork and exceptional stuff gets encrusted with diamonds or studded with electrum.
